Hello,
I was going to replace the keyless entry door handle sensor, but some problems occurred. - First I removed the rubber grommet and unscrew the Torx 20 until it came to a stop. - Then I held the handle a little way up, and gave the Torx 20 a firm press to release the key part of the handle. Handle locked up and I think I did it right. - After that I tried to remove the key part of the handle, but it did not come out. - Then I thought that maybe the handle was not locked properly earlier and I decided to start again from point zero and screwed the Torx 20 clockwise in the starting position. - I repeated same steps couple times and got the handle locked up. Still the key part of the handle did not come out. - I was going to repeat steps once again, but noticed that the Torx 20 was loose and I was not able to screw or unscrew it. It looks like that it's just lies in the little chamber freely as you can see in the picture enclosed. Have anyone faced this kind of problem and how to solve it? I tried to pull Torx 20 backwards with pliers but it did not help. The door still opens and closes fine, so I suppose that the handle mechanism is still in the correct position. Thanks in advance. |

Be careful, if it doesn't lock in properly and you back the screw in and out, it can come loose and end up dropping into the door, which is a massive pain to get back out..... I spent about two hours stripping the door card and fishing with a magnet
Sadly, I can't offer much advice as to how to get the handle off, three of mine were as per the instructions, one was a pain and I still to this day am not 100% sure how it came out |
